Media Review – 14th, July 2025

Media Review – 14th, July 2025

by gcic / Monday, 14 July 2025 / Published in Media Review

NEWVISION

PRESIDENT MUSEVENI FLAGS OFF KAYUNGA-GALIRAYA ROAD CONSTRUCTION

 Page: 2

Summary:  President Yoweri Museveni has flagged off the construction of the Kayunga-Bbaale-Galiraya Road, which will reshape regional connectivity and unlock economic opportunities across Central, Northern and North-Eastern Uganda.

GOVERNMENT RECEIVES LAND TITLES FOR BUNYORO UNIVERSITY

Page: 4

Summary: The Ministry of Education and Sports has officially received land titles for 97.02 acres donated by Dr. Henry Wamani and the family to host the long-awaited Bunyoro University. This donation provides the Government’s Public University in Bunyoro Sub-region with a permanent home, bringing the university closer to reality.

WORKS MINISTRY, CAA IMPLEMENT DIRECTIVE ON SACKING STAFF

Page: 6

Summary: The Works Ministry and the Uganda Civil Aviation Authority (UCAA) have started implementing President Museveni’s directive to sack 152 staff who were reportedly recruited irregularly. In a letter to Works and Transport Minister, Gen. Katumba Wamala dated 25, June 2025, the President demanded the immediate sacking of the staff after he got information that they were hired on account of fake academic qualifications.

GEN. MUHOOZI, UAE COUNTERPART COMMIT TO STRENGTHENING MILITARY COOPERATION

Page: 8

Summary: The Chief of Defence Forces, Gen. Muhoozi Kainerugaba, on Friday held talks with Lt. Gen. Issa Saif Mohammed Al Mazrouei, the Chief of Staff of the UAE Armed Forces, to enhance military co-operation between Uganda and the United Arab Emirates (UAE).

GOVERNMENT TO RESTORE 3,278.15 HECTARES OF DEGRADED WETLANDS

Page: 10

Summary: The Government, through the Environment Ministry, has started the process of restoring 3,278.15 hectares of degraded wetlands in three hotspot Districts in Eastern Uganda.

SPORTS EDITION

UGANDA TO SHOWCASE CULTURE AT THE WORLD UNIVERSITY GAMES

Page: 50

Summary: As Team Uganda prepares for the FISU World University Games in Germany this July from 16-27, the Uganda Tourism Board (UTB) has extended a cultural gift package to the delegation, reinforcing the power of sport as a tool for diplomacy and national branding.

DAILY MONITOR

GOVERNMENT APPROVES 9 TOWN COUNCILS AHEAD OF 2026

Page: 2

Summary: The Government has approved the creation of nine new Town Councils ahead of the 2026 General Elections. The new Town Councils, which are deemed to have become operational on July 1, 2025, are spread out in nine cities in the country.

GOVERNMENT ORDERS SCHOOLS TO RECOVER TIME LOST DURING ARTS TEACHERS’ STRIKE

Page: 5

Summary: The Ministry of Education and Sports has directed all government and government-aided secondary schools to implement measures to recover learning time lost during the recent strike by Arts teachers under the Uganda Professional Humanities Teachers’ Union (UPHTU).

NITA-U WEBSITE

GOVERNMENT LAUNCHES FREE PUBLIC WI-FI IN BWERA TO ADVANCE DIGITAL ACCESS

Summary: On Sunday, July 13, 2025, the Government of Uganda, through the National Information Technology Authority – Uganda (NITA-U), officially launched Free Public Wi-Fi in Bwera Town, Kasese District. This milestone initiative is part of Uganda’s broader digital acceleration agenda aimed at expanding affordable internet access to underserved communities.
